I'm having a bit of a problem with percentage formatting. I'm using TM1 10.2 Performance Modeller / Architect for editing dimensions and element formattings.
The problem is that the cell formatting seems to activate only after a user enters some data into that specific cell. If I enter for example 50, I get 5000%. Now if I enter 50 again, I get 50% which was the intention in the first place. Furthermore, if I now remove the value from the cell already edited, the formatting works correctly because it is kind of activated.
So is this intended behaviour and might some one know an alternative formatting to achieve a more user friendly behaviour. I'm also using 'empty if zero' condition in the formatting.

Re: TM1 percentage formatting
Intended behavior. You should enter the value as 0.50 to get 50%
